I'm hoping for some info from those of you who have used Storm Lake Glock barrels.  I have a Glock 35 that I am happy with.  But, all this talk about Glock 40 KB's has got me a bit concerned.  I'm loading 165 gr Remingtons and Rainiers with AAs max reccommended load of #5 - no problems.  But it's a fact - that chamber is loose, and unsupported.

Questions:  Are Storm Lake Glock Barrels fully supported?  Were they easy to fit?  Did you see an improvement in accuracy?  And anything else you think I should kno

Only have Storm Lake in my G29 and has more support than stock. Happy with SL. Also a drop in fit as were all of my other barrels.

Also have KKMs in my G20, G30, G33 and also pleased with KKM. Support also is better than stock

Have EFK in my G32 and no problems there either
